The Old Wives' Tale

About The Book

<p><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>In the heart of Victorian England Arnold Bennett's masterpiece </span><em style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>The Old Wives' Tale</em><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)> weaves the captivating stories of the Baines sisters Constance and Sophia. Born into the modest comfort of a draper's family in the provincial town of Bursley their paths diverge wildly as they navigate through love loss ambition and the relentless march of time.</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)> Constance the steadfast elder embraces the predictable rhythms of life within the bounds of their family shop finding contentment in domesticity and familiar surroundings. Sophia the spirited younger sister breaks free from the constraints of provincial life embarking on a thrilling tumultuous journey that takes her far from home. Their tales crisscross the changing landscape of the nineteenth century revealing the profound impacts of time and choice upon individual destinies.</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)> Arnold Bennett masterfully chronicles the ordinary and extraordinary events that shape the sisters' lives offering a poignant detailed portrait of Victorian England. </span><em style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>The Old Wives' Tale</em><span style=color: rgba(0 0 0 1)> is not just the story of Constance and Sophia; it is a powerful timeless exploration of human nature family bonds and the surprising resilience of the female spirit.</span></p>
